Short Answer: Lithium batteries outperform lead-acid in solar storage with higher efficiency (95% vs. 80%), longer lifespan (10-15 vs. 3-5 years), and deeper discharge capacity. Though 3x pricier upfront, lithium’s lower lifetime costs and space efficiency make them ideal for modern solar systems.. Most commonly, BESS are used in grid electricity use time shifting, voltage regulation (sometimes in conjunction with wind or solar photovoltaic generation). BESS can be designed for operation in two modes: (1) grid tied, and (2) islanded mode during grid power outages. appropriate battery power. . Outdoor battery. . The SRB6 Battery Cabinet is an outdoor-rated enclosure that can hold up to 6x SR5K-UL battery modules for a total energy capacity of 30 kWh. The cabinet is outdoor-rated with automatic, temperature-controlled cooling fans (120VAC) to keep batteries operating at optimal temperature. The cabinet. .
